While nursing my baby girl one morning, I realized my maternity leave was coming to an end. I quickly had to figure out how I was going to keep my supply up (lost of water and oatmeal). Most importantly, how I was going to pump while at work, since I was still nursing. Granted I do have an office, but I am on the road a lot; driving from client office to client office. I had to figure out where to keep my actual pump; the parts that come with pumping and how to keep the milk cool while out on the road. I needed one that worked best for me.

There was some trial and error but I finally got it. I figured out a routine that works best for me and my busy work schedule. Every morning I leave the house with various bags, seriously, my co-workers call me the “bag lady”. I have my purse/MK backpack, my bag that carries my pump and parts, my little black bag that has my ice packs and bottles, and then my work bag which funny enough carries my work items; laptop, note books and paperwork.

Before leaving for work I make sure to nurse my little one, then I start my 3-hour timer from that last nursing session. Once the timer goes off, depending on where I am, I will pump right away. The longest I’ve gone between pumping sessions was 5 hours and boy will I never do that again. If I am at the office then I will post my “Privacy” sign on my office door and pump there.

If I am on the road then I will pump in my car, yes, you heard that right- in my car! Once in my car I will pull into a parking lot and park in a secluded space. I then put up the sun shade (don’t want to give anyone a peep show), plug my pump into the outlet adapter, situate myself and then start the race to see which boob finishes faster! I store the milk in my little, insulated bag with ice packs and continue my adventures of my work day all the while anticipating the next session.

Choosing to pump while working full time is not easy by any means, but i’m happy with my decision and what I’m providing for my daughter.
